PMQ Pizza Magazine celebrates National Pizza Week with #Followthepizza giveaway

PMQ Pizza Magazine is starting 2014 off right with a celebration of pizza and giving. To commemorate National Pizza Week, we have started a unique experiment of random acts of pizza giving. We will follow the pizza trail for one year using social media.


To get the process started, we have randomly selected five people this week to receive a free pizza courtesy of PMQ from throughout the country. In turn, each recipient is encouraged to order a free pizza for another person (it can be a friend, an acquaintance, a person in need or a total stranger - anyone you choose), with the goal of establishing a long chain of pizza-giving in the social media world. Using the hashtag #followthepizza, we will see if the trail picks up - and branches out - online.


Meanwhile, PMQ encourages people to start their own random act of pizza kindness by simply sending out the instructions below with a pizza donation to anyone they choose.


We randomly selected recipients in Nevada, New Jersey, Virginia, Michigan and Mississippi to start. We reached out to PMQ subscribers that provide pizza delivery to help us find recipients. Within hours we had a great response.


The first pizza went out with the help of MonAlyssa Italian Restaurant and Pizzeria in Point Pleasant, New Jersey. They liked the idea so much that they doubled the offer with a free pizza of their own to a customer. Up next was Pulcinella Pizzeria in Fort Collins, Colorado who provided a pizza to a surprise customer. Melting Pot Pizza in Royal, Virginia surprised a recent college graduate. Today, #Followthepizza surprises are expected at Sal & Mookie's in Jackson, Mississippi and Chubby Charlie's Pizza in Commerce, Michigan.


Taking it upon themselves, Rio Vista Pizza Factory in Rio Vista, California also participated providing their own free pizza out to a customer.

About PMQ Pizza Magazine
Now in it's 17th year, PMQ Pizza Magazine has a national circulation of 40,000 with over 20,000 web visitors each month. There are over 14,000 subscribed to the weekly e-newsletter. The trade magazine focuses on marketing content for pizzerias and is published 10 times a year out of Oxford, Miss. To learn more visit www.pmq.com.
